Alexa Grand

Alexa Grand

Certified Physician Assistant

Certified by the National Commission on Certification of Physician Assistants
Alexa Grand was raised in San Antonio, TX. After high school, she moved to Fayetteville to attend the University of Arkansas, where she ear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Chemistry, with a biochemistry focus. She was a member of Arkansas’ Division I Track and Field program and earned several SEC scholar athlete awards. During her undergraduate studies, she shadowed at Hull Dermatology and found a true vocation for dermatology. She became interested in the complexities of dermatology and felt she could make a positive impact in the field. Several of her family members, as well as herself, have been affected by various dermatologic conditions, solidifying her interest in the field.

After graduating from Arkansas, she attended Texas Tech University Health Sciences Center and received her Master of Physician Assistant Studies. She graduated as a member of the Pi Alpha National Honor Society, which recognizes achievement in scholarship, service, and leadership. After graduating from PA school, Alexa joined a dermatology clinic in Lubbock, TX and practiced medical and cosmetic dermatology. She has been awarded Diplomate status by the Society of Dermatology Physician Assistants due to her knowledge and training in dermatology.

Alexa is excited to relocate back to Northwest Arkansas and feels blessed to be able to work at Hull Dermatology, where her passion for dermatology began. She feels honored to serve the people of the Northwest Arkansas community and beyond. Alexa is married to her husband, Rob. In her spare time, she enjoys outdoor activities, watching sports, and spending quality time with friends and family.
